An ANA (antinuclear antibody) test is a widely used clinical tool that helps assess whether the immune system may be reacting against the body's own cells. It is commonly used as an initial investigation when autoimmune conditions are suspected.
However, autoimmune conditions can be complex and difficult to identify. Symptoms such as fatigue, joint discomfort and inflammation often overlap with other health concerns, and immune activity can involve multiple pathways beyond those assessed by ANA alone.

This test is used to detect autoantibodies that are commonly found in people with autoimmune diseases, such as lupus or Sjögren's syndrome.
CRP is a marker of inflammation - a strong risk factor for heart disease, and linked to diabetes, obesity, high blood pressure, and some cancers.
